Heriot-Watt University Dubai onboards Cosentino Design Challenge 15

11 March 2021

Dubai branch of British university incorporates CDC15 as part of 2021 course curriculum

Cosentino Middle East, the regional headquarters of global architectural surfaces leader Cosentino Group, partners with Heriot-Watt University Dubai to introduce the international Cosentino Design Challenge (CDC) as course work for the 2nd year Interior Design students of the Heriot-Watt School of Textile and Design.

Now in its 15th edition, CDC is a global initiative in line with the group’s ongoing commitment to foster the talent and creativity of future professionals in architecture and design. The challenge also gives students a chance to connect with the materials and products of Cosentino as they research and create their design propositions. While this hugely successful initiative has had the support and collaboration of 32 international schools and universities, this is the first time a UAE based university officially comes onboard.

Commenting on their involvement, Dr. Malini Karani, Director of Studies for Interior Design (Undergraduate and Postgraduate), Heriot-Watt University Dubai said, “I am delighted that our students from the second year Studio course at Heriot-Watt University Dubai’s School of Textiles and Design are participating in the Cosentino Design Challenge, one of the most prestigious student competitions of today. Platforms such as these offer budding designers a chance to think creatively and on an international scale, explore technical aspects that are critical to this profession and challenge themselves. I wish our students the very best, and thank Cosentino for this unique opportunity.”

This year’s edition is looking for inspiring ideas in Architecture under the theme “Kitchens with soul – new visions for everyday space” and in the Design category, students are asked to reflect on “Cosentino…materials and sensations”. Participants have absolute freedom to develop their projects with the only requirement being that they include some of Cosentino’s innovative engineered surfaces: Silestone and/or Dekton.

Last year’s CDC attracted 213 submissions in the Architecture category and 150 in the Design category from students across Europe, America and Asia. This year’s submissions will include representation from the Middle East thanks to the participation of Heriot-Watt University Dubai.

The Cosentino Design Challenge 15 is also open for participation to independent student designers. Deadline to submit projects is 1st June 2021.

About the Cosentino Group

Cosentino Group is a global, family-owned company that produces and distributes high value innovative surfaces for architecture and design. As a leading company, Cosentino imagines and anticipates together with its customers and partners design solutions that offer value and inspiration to people’s lives. This goal is made possible by pioneering brands that are leaders in their respective segments such as Silestone® and Dekton® by Cosentino®. Technologically advanced surfaces, which allow the creation of unique designs for the home and public spaces.

The group bases its development on international expansion, an innovative research and development program, respect for the environment and sustainability, and its ongoing corporate commitment to society and the local communities where it operates, education, equality and health & safety.

Cosentino Group currently distributes its products and brands in more than 110 countries, from its headquarters in Almeria (Spain), and it’s present with its own assets in 30 of them. The group has 8 factories (7 in Almería, Spain and 1 in Brazil), 1 intelligent logistic platform in Spain, and 140 commercial and business units throughout the world. More than 90% of Cosentino Group’s financial turnover comes from international markets.
